数据包捕获技术:如何捕获和分析网络数据包

时间:2025-12-15 分类:网络技术

数据包捕获技术是网络管理和安全保障中不可或缺的一部分。随着互联网的快速发展,网络数据变得愈发复杂,如何有效地捕获和分析这些数据包成为许多IT专业人士关注的重要课题。数据包捕获技术不仅可以帮助网络管理员监测网络流量、识别异常行为,还能为网络安全提供有效的支持。掌握这项技术,对于保障企业网络安全、优化网络性能以及解决网络故障具有重要意义。

数据包捕获技术:如何捕获和分析网络数据包

了解数据包的基本构成是掌握数据包捕获技术的第一步。数据包是网络通讯的基本单位,通常包括头部和负载两部分。头部包含了源和目的地址、协议类型等信息,而负载则是进行传输的数据。通过观察数据包的结构,IT专业人士能够更好地理解网络流量的特征和行为。

数据包捕获的工具有多种,其中最为人熟知的便是Wireshark。这款开源软件功能强大,能够实时捕获网络上传输的数据包,并提供详细的解析工具。利用Wireshark,用户可以对捕获的数据包进行深度分析,识别出潜在的安全威胁、性能瓶颈等问题。其直观的用户界面和丰富的过滤选项使得即便是初学者也能快速上手。

除了Wireshark,市场上还有其他多种数据包捕获工具,比如Tcpdump和Microsoft Network Monitor等。每种工具都有其独特的功能和适用场景,用户可以根据具体需求选择合适的工具来进行数据包的捕获和分析。了解这些工具的优劣势,有助于网络工程师在实际工作中做出合理的选择和调整。

在数据包捕获的过程中,数据的存储和管理也是不可忽视的重要环节。捕获到的数据包往往会占用大量的存储空间,因此需要设定合理的存储策略。为了避免数据丢失,应该定期备份数据包文件,并保持对重要数据的完整性检查。

数据包分析不仅仅是技术问题,更涉及到数据隐私和网络。在进行数据捕获时,务必遵循相关法律法规,保护用户信息安全,避免不必要的法律风险。通过规范的数据包捕获和分析流程,不仅可以提升网络安全性,还能增强用户对网络环境的信任。

数据包捕获技术是一项极具价值的技能,它能够帮助我们深入理解网络工作机制,提高网络安全性,并为网络故障排除提供有效支持。掌握这一技术,将对网络管理和运维工作产生积极的影响。